An electron spin resonance study of trivinylmethyl and hepta-2,6-dien-4-ynyl radicals

Trivinylmethyl radicals were generated by hydrogen abstraction from trivinylmethane and hepta-2,6-dien-4-ynyl radicals were produced by bromine abstraction from 1-bromohepta-2,6-dien-4-yne. The e.s.r. spectra of the radicals were obtained and the hyperfine splittings compared with computed spin densities.
